Lecturer profileDi Gammage MA Core Process Psychotherapist UKCP

Registered Child & Adult Psychotherapist. With 25 years’ experience working in the area of trauma and abuse, Di is qualified in dramatherapy and play therapy. Di was invited onto the UK Council for Psychotherapy Child Register via the Northern School of Child Psychotherapy in recognition of her clinical experience and publications in child therapy.
Her adult training is in Buddhist Psychotherapy. Di has been Co-director of Sirona Therapeutic Horsemanship Project, Devon, and has published and presented on the benefits of equine therapy, particularly for looked-after children who have experienced attachment breakdown. She lectures on the Terapia Child and Adolescent Psychotherapy programme in London, NESTT Psychotherapy Training in Yorkshire and Athryma Play and Dramatherapy Training in Athens.
Her interest in resilience has developed over years of practicing as a psychotherapist and clinical supervisor.
Di has regularly delivered programmes for Health Education England.
